Ellen Chen Location
San Francisco, CA, US
Ellen Chen Work
Ellen Chen Education
University of Toronto
Bachelor of Applied Science - BASc (Computer Engineering)
2018 - 2023
William Lyon Mackenzie Collegiate Institute
High School Diploma (Mathematics and Computer Science)
2014 - 2018
Ellen Chen Summary
Ellen Chen, based in San Francisco, CA, US, is currently a Software Engineer at Discord. Ellen Chen brings experience from previous roles at Cambly Inc. and Scotiabank. Ellen Chen holds a 2018 - 2023 Bachelor of Applied Science - BASc in Computer Engineering @ University of Toronto. Ellen Chen has 2 emails and 1 mobile phone numbers on RocketReach.